  1. Sharon Stewart-Wells says:

    Your horse has left the ground unevenly behind and from a very long distance causing him to jump “at” the jump instead of rocking up and over it. Your horse is using his knees well. Your position looks good. I think you are up from his neck enough and your release is good. If you look forward and higher with your eye, it will raise your chin and straighten your back a little more. This is a small detail to fix. Nice job.
